  The coalition of Civil Society Organisations (CSOs) and concerned citizens have decried silence of the region's governors and commissioners of education over the 2025 JAMB's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ME). The JAMB leadership recently admitted and took responsibility of the widespread irregularities and apparent systemic failures that marred the 2025 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ME) in South-East and some areas in Lagos State. The 17 CSOs and 12 concerned citizens in a three-page statement, which was fully jointly signed on Tuesday in Enugu, described the "conspicuous silence from the executive arm of South-East governments as both worrisome, perplexing and unsettling." The statement is titled: "The Silence that Speaks Volumes: South-East Governors and Commissioners of Education, Your Constituents Demand Your Voice on the JAMB Crisis."   The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has appointed renowned political strategist, party administrator and public affairs analyst, Steve Oruruo, as Chairman of its South East Zonal Disciplinary Committee. The announcement was made during a closed-door meeting of the PDP South East Zonal Executive Committee, as the party moves to reinforce internal discipline and ensure stability in the zone ahead of key political realignments. Other members of the committee include respected legal luminary, Clem Ezika, SAN, who will serve as Secretary, while Sir Tony Ezebuiro, Chief Emeka Irem, and Barr. Fortune Akujuobi are to serve as members. Speaking shortly after the announcement, Oruruo emphasized the constitutional basis for the committee’s creation. “It is in line with the provisions of the Constitution of the Party. In a decisive move to curb extortion and illegal revenue collection in local markets, the Enugu State Market Monitoring Team and The Staff of Enugu State Revenue Services have apprehended several individuals allegedly involved in the collection of unauthorized levies from traders at Orie Nara Market in Nkanu East Local Government Area. The operation, which took place this morning, Tuesday, 6th of May 2025, was carried out by a Special Taskforce Team under the Enugu State Market Liaison Office,  led by Hon. Dr. Chinedu Mbah, the Senior Special Assistant to the Governor on Market Liaison and the Enugu State Revenue Service. The raid involved both government agents and members of the Market Taskforce Team, who acted swiftly following credible intelligence on the illegal activities.
